OpenLife reports that Lagos content creator Ella recently drew attention to the daily struggles commuters face with the Lagos Bus Rapid Transit system, sparking conversations across social media.
In a video she shared, Ella described the long waits and overcrowded buses that many residents experience every day.
Her message resonated widely, with many Lagos residents sharing similar frustrations and praising her for raising awareness about the city’s transportation challenges.
Following the viral attention, Ella’s employer took steps to acknowledge her advocacy. In a heartwarming moment captured on video, she was presented with a one-year transport allowance as a token of appreciation for her efforts.
According to those present, the gesture was meant to recognize her role in highlighting the difficulties commuters face daily.
“The gesture was meant to acknowledge her effort in drawing attention to the transportation difficulties experienced by many residents in Lagos,” they said.
Ella’s story has inspired discussions about public transport in Lagos and showcased the impact a single voice can have in shedding light on real-life urban challenges.
